| Supplier Type | Typical Location | Key Features | Considerations for Buyers |
|---|---|---|---|
| Original Equipment Manufacturers (OEM) | Vietnam, Thailand | Full design, production, and testing; often offer custom branding | Best for large-volume orders; request ISO certification and test reports |
| Trading Companies / Export Agents | Indonesia, Malaysia | Source from multiple factories; handle export documentation | Verify actual factory behind the trader; request samples before mass order |
| Specialized Hydraulic Equipment Manufacturers | Philippines, Singapore (assembly) | Focus on hydraulic systems; may offer after-sales support | Check warranty terms and availability of spare parts locally |
| Second-hand / Refurbished Suppliers | Regional hubs (e.g., Singapore) | Lower cost but variable quality | Inspect thoroughly; request maintenance history and testing video |

Key Factors to Evaluate When Selecting a Supplier
- Certifications: Look for ISO 9001 (quality management), CE (European safety), or equivalent certifications. These indicate a commitment to quality and safety.
- Technical Specifications: Check the splitting force (measured in tons), hydraulic pressure range, operating temperature, and compatibility with different rock types.
- Customization Capability: Does the supplier offer custom sizes, colors, or branding? Can they adapt to your specific project requirements?
- After-Sales Support: Inquire about warranty periods, spare parts availability, and technical support. A local distributor in your region can be a plus.
- Production Capacity: Ensure the supplier can meet your order volume and lead times. Ask about their current production backlog.
- Reference Projects: Request case studies or references from past clients, especially those in similar industries (mining, construction, quarrying).
Step-by-Step Import Checklist for ASEAN Sourcing
- Define Your Requirements: Determine the number of units, splitting force, operating pressure, and any special features (e.g., remote control, noise reduction).
- Shortlist Suppliers: Use online B2B platforms (e.g., Alibaba, Global Sources) and regional trade directories. Attend trade shows like Vietnam Mining or Indonesian Construction Expo.
- Request Quotations: Ask for detailed quotes including unit price, MOQ, payment terms (typically 30% advance, 70% before shipment), and delivery timeline.
- Evaluate Samples: Always request a sample unit or a video demonstration. If possible, visit the factory to inspect production processes.
- Negotiate Terms: Discuss Incoterms (FOB, CIF, EXW), quality inspection (e.g., SGS or third-party), and penalty clauses for delays.
- Arrange Logistics: Choose a reliable freight forwarder experienced in heavy equipment. Confirm container loading, port handling, and customs clearance in your destination country.
- Handle Compliance: Check import duties, taxes, and any safety regulations in your country. Ensure the equipment meets local electrical and hydraulic standards.
- Plan for Installation and Training: Some suppliers offer on-site installation and operator training. If not, request detailed manuals and video guides.
Risks and How to Mitigate Them
Importing heavy equipment always carries risks. The most common issues include quality inconsistency, delayed shipments, and hidden costs. To mitigate these:
- Quality Risk: Use a third-party inspection service before shipment. Test the equipment under load to verify performance.
- Logistics Risk: Work with a freight forwarder that specializes in oversized cargo. Confirm all port charges and inland transportation costs in advance.
- Compliance Risk: Consult with a customs broker in your country to ensure the equipment meets all import regulations. Some countries require specific safety certifications for hydraulic equipment.
- Payment Risk: Use letters of credit (L/C) for large orders, or split payments based on milestones (e.g., 30% deposit, 40% after inspection, 30% before shipping).
Cost Breakdown for Budgeting
When budgeting, consider not only the purchase price but also shipping, insurance, customs duties, and potential modification costs. Typically, a hydraulic rock splitting bar unit from ASEAN suppliers ranges from $2,000 to $15,000 depending on capacity and quality. Freight costs for a 20-foot container from Vietnam to the US or Europe can be $1,500–$3,000, while to Australia or the Middle East may be slightly lower. Always request a full cost breakdown from your supplier and forwarder.
